Born in Poteet, Texas, in 1952, Strait grew up in nearby Pearsall. His dad was a math teacher who also operated their family ranch. "My dad didn't even have a record player," Strait has said. "When he listened to the radio, it was usually for the news or the cow market reports."

Now 73 years old, Strait is called the King of Country, but that almost feels like an understatement: The "Amarillo by Morning" singer has had not six, but sixty No. 1 hits and sold over 70 million albums! Throughout his incredible journey, Strait has always stayed true to himself and never let fame define or change him.

In 2014, he announced his "farewell tour"—but like many great artists, retirement didn't quite stick. Over a decade later, he's still selling out arenas.
